Khepri didn't often care for getting her claws dirty. The kajiit was a simple woman, septims, travel, and her precious kittens where all she needed really to feel content.

Sharp turquoise eyes narrowed into the darkness of the cave she had found herself in before driving her ebony blade into the gut of the man who thought he was any match for one of her skill. Khepri snorted before pulling the blade out so the man would drop dead. She whipped the blood from her blade using the corpses tunic before rifling through his belongings and pocketing a few septim she could hand the girls when she came to visit them later tomorrow.

She was in the area near Falkreath on business for the guild, some human man thinking he could dare try to make a rival faction to her guild.

Skyrims Thieves Guild was second to none and she preferred it that way. Yes it meant more enemies, but they were protected by their wits and ability to blend in well with a crowd. Some still believed they were but myth, and while she laughed in the face of their ignorance, she preferred it stay so, less of a target on the guilds back.
____

With the small group of wannabe thieves taken care of, Khepri relaxed outside the terrorized hideout, stretching her legs as she waited her horse to finish her meal. She would head to her manor that housed the kittens after.
